Few AR setups create more barrel length debate than a suppressed 300 Blackout. The cartridge was built around short barrels, heavy bullets, and suppressor use, so it gives shooters more usable options than many rifle calibers. That flexibility creates confusion. A 5 inch gun, an 8.5 inch gun, and a 10.5 inch gun can all make sense, depending on the role.

The right answer starts with the job. A suppressed 300 Blackout used for home defense has different priorities than one carried in a side by side during hog season. A range gun built around subsonic ammunition has different needs than a compact hunting rifle loaded with supersonic expanding bullets. Barrel length affects velocity, dwell time, reliability, suppressor handling, noise, flash, heat, and transport. Treat it as a system decision, not a cosmetic choice.

Why 300 Blackout Works Well in Short Barrels

300 Blackout burns powder efficiently in shorter barrels compared with many centerfire rifle cartridges. That is one reason it became popular for compact AR platforms. A 5.56 NATO rifle loses substantial performance when the barrel gets very short. 300 Blackout gives up velocity as barrel length shrinks too, but it usually remains more practical in the 7 to 10 inch range.

Subsonic ammunition changes the conversation further. Heavy 190 to 220 grain bullets are generally loaded to stay below the speed of sound, so extra barrel length offers limited benefit once the load reaches its intended velocity. Supersonic 300 Blackout loads benefit more from additional barrel, especially for hunting where expansion threshold matters.

The Practical Barrel Length Ranges

5 to 6 Inches

Ultra short barrels make the firearm very compact, especially with a suppressor attached. This setup suits close quarters storage, backpack carry where lawful, and specialized range use. The tradeoffs are real. Short systems can be more sensitive to ammunition, gas tuning, buffer weight, and suppressor back pressure. Muzzle pressure is higher, heat builds quickly, and suppressor mounting stress deserves attention.

This length range favors experienced owners who understand tuning and who will test their specific ammunition. It can work very well with subsonic loads and the right suppressor, but it leaves less margin for poor magazines, weak ammunition, or inconsistent maintenance.

7 to 8.5 Inches

This is the practical center of the suppressed 300 Blackout world. It keeps the rifle short after adding a can, while giving the gas system enough room to run with a broader ammunition spread. Many shooters who use both subsonic and supersonic loads find this range easier to live with than the shortest barrels.

For home defense, range use, and general compact AR ownership, 7 to 8.5 inches offers a strong balance. The firearm remains maneuverable in vehicles, blinds, and indoor training spaces. Suppressed overall length stays reasonable. Reliability is usually easier to achieve with common pistol length gas systems.

9 to 10.5 Inches

A 9 to 10.5 inch 300 Blackout gives more supersonic velocity and generally improves system forgiveness. Hunters should pay attention here. Expanding bullets need enough impact velocity to perform properly, and every inch of barrel can matter when the shot stretches past close range.

This length range still works well suppressed, although the finished package feels longer. If your rifle spends more time in the field than staged in a compact storage location, the extra barrel can be worthwhile. For a do everything 300 Blackout build, 9 inches is a common sweet spot.

11 to 12.5 Inches

Longer 300 Blackout barrels make sense for shooters who prioritize supersonic performance, hunting use, and smoother gas behavior. The cartridge still functions with subsonic ammunition, but the suppressor equipped platform starts to lose the compact advantage that draws many owners to 300 Blackout in the first place.

This range is useful for owners who want one rifle for training, hunting, and occasional suppressed use. It gives up some handling speed in tight spaces and adds length in the case, vehicle, or blind.

Subsonic Versus Supersonic Use

Before choosing a barrel, decide which ammunition you will use most. Subsonic 300 Blackout is valued for suppressed shooting comfort, lower blast, and reduced signature. It still requires serious terminal performance evaluation. Heavy full metal jacket range loads behave differently than purpose built expanding subsonic ammunition.

Supersonic 300 Blackout produces more energy, flatter trajectory, and better hunting utility. It also creates more noise, more recoil impulse, and a sharper report through the suppressor. A short barrel can still run supersonic ammunition, but hunting loads should be tested at realistic distances to confirm accuracy and expected impact velocity.

A simple rule helps: if the rifle is mostly a suppressed subsonic tool, look hard at 7 to 9 inches. If it will hunt with supersonic expanding loads, consider 9 to 10.5 inches or longer based on your terrain and shot distance.

Reliability Comes From the Whole System

Barrel length is only one part of reliability. Gas port size, gas system length, bolt carrier mass, buffer weight, recoil spring, magazine quality, suppressor back pressure, and ammunition all interact. A suppressed rifle often cycles harder because the suppressor keeps pressure in the system longer. That can increase fouling, bolt speed, gas to the shooter, and parts wear.

An adjustable gas block, tuned buffer, or suppressor optimized charging handle may improve comfort and consistency, although each added part brings its own maintenance considerations. Owners who switch between subs and supers should test both loads with the suppressor attached and removed, if that matches real use. A rifle that functions perfectly with one load may short stroke, over gas, or lock back inconsistently with another.

Twist Rate and Suppressor Safety

Short suppressed 300 Blackout builds demand attention to bullet stability. Heavy subsonic bullets need adequate twist. Common twist rates such as 1:7 are widely used, while some very short barrels use faster twist rates to stabilize long heavy bullets sooner. The exact choice depends on bullet weight, barrel length, and load.

Suppressor safety requires verification. Before sending rounds through a suppressor, confirm the firearm prints clean round holes on paper at close range with the intended ammunition. Keyholing signals instability and raises the risk of a baffle or end cap strike. Check suppressor alignment, mount tightness, and barrel shoulder quality. A compact rifle that loosens mounts under heat can become expensive quickly.

A short barrel and a suppressor can place the firearm under federal regulation, and state laws may add restrictions. Barrel length, overall length, stock configuration, suppressor possession, transport, and hunting use should be reviewed before purchase or assembly. This is especially important when moving across state lines or traveling for a class or hunt.

Owners should document serial numbered items, store regulated components securely, and keep copies of required paperwork where appropriate. Compliance is part of responsible ownership, just like safe storage and safe handling.

Maintenance and Long Term Ownership

Suppressed 300 Blackout rifles get dirty fast. Carbon, unburned powder, and lubricant residue collect in the receiver, bolt carrier group, chamber, magazines, and suppressor mount. Subsonic ammunition can be especially dirty depending on the load. A rifle that runs during a short range trip may behave differently after several hundred suppressed rounds without cleaning.

Build a maintenance schedule around use. Inspect the gas rings, extractor, ejector, buffer spring, and suppressor mount. Clean the chamber, bolt tail, locking lugs, and magazine feed lips. If the suppressor is user serviceable, follow the manufacturer recommended service interval. If it is a sealed rifle suppressor, monitor weight gain, mount condition, and accuracy changes over time.

A Simple Barrel Length Checklist

  • Primary use: home defense, hunting, training, vehicle carry, or range shooting.
  • Main ammunition: subsonic, supersonic, or a realistic mix of both.
  • Suppressor size: short can for handling or larger can for sound reduction.
  • Reliability margin: how much tuning are you willing to do.
  • Legal status: barrel length, suppressor ownership, transport, and state restrictions.
  • Storage and carry: safe size, case length, vehicle fit, and field packability.
  • Maintenance tolerance: cleaning frequency, carbon buildup, and parts inspection.

Bottom Line

For most suppressed 300 Blackout owners, a 7 to 9 inch barrel is the most practical starting point. It preserves the compact advantage of the cartridge, supports suppressor use well, and offers a manageable reliability window. Hunters and shooters who favor supersonic ammunition should look toward 9 to 10.5 inches for added velocity and terminal performance. Ultra short barrels make sense for specialized compact builds when the owner is ready to tune, test, and maintain the system carefully.

The best suppressed 300 Blackout is the one that matches your actual use, runs your chosen ammunition, stays compliant, and remains easy to maintain over years of ownership.
